What does a Graduate Project Manager do at Grayce?

You'll be placed on-site with one of our clients, working as part of their project delivery teams. Your role will focus on:

  • Supporting project delivery from planning through to execution and evaluation
  • Managing timelines, resources, risks, and stakeholder communications
  • Monitoring and reporting project progress to senior managers
  • Helping to define scope, break down tasks and ensure everything runs smoothly
  • Finding smart solutions to blockers and bottlenecks
  • Learning and applying industry tools such as Critical Path Analysis, Resource Planning, and Agile or Waterfall methodology.

As a Junior Project Manager, you'll be the glue that holds the project together. A key contact who keeps everything on track, ensures everyone's aligned and communicates progress clearly to all stakeholders.
